What Are the Key Features to Look for in a Portable Battery Charger for the Axon 7?

When searching for the best portable battery charger for the Axon 7, consider the following key features:

  • Battery Capacity: A higher mAh rating indicates greater capacity, allowing you to charge your Axon 7 multiple times before needing to recharge the power bank itself.
  • Output Power: Look for chargers with at least 2.1A output to ensure fast charging capability, ensuring your device gets powered up quickly.
  • Portability: Compact and lightweight designs are ideal for on-the-go charging, making it easy to carry the charger in your bag or pocket without adding much bulk.
  • Multiple Ports: Having multiple output ports allows you to charge more than one device simultaneously, which is particularly useful if you own multiple gadgets.
  • Smart Charging Technology: Features like Quick Charge or Power Delivery can optimize charging speeds for your Axon 7, enhancing efficiency and reducing charging time.
  • Build Quality and Safety Features: Choose a charger made from durable materials that include safety features such as overcharge protection, short-circuit protection, and temperature control to ensure safe usage.
  • Indicator Lights: LED indicators can show the remaining battery life of the charger, helping you know when it’s time to recharge the power bank itself.

Battery capacity is a critical factor as it determines how many times you can recharge your Axon 7 without needing to recharge the portable charger. A charger with a capacity of 10,000mAh or higher is recommended for several full charges.

Output power is essential for fast charging; chargers with 2.1A or higher will provide quicker charging times, making them suitable for users who are often in a hurry. This will ensure that your Axon 7 receives the necessary power efficiently.

Portability is also important, as you want a charger that is easy to carry around. A lightweight and compact design means you can take it with you everywhere without feeling weighed down.

If you own multiple devices, look for a charger with multiple ports. This feature allows you to power up more than one device at the same time, making it a versatile choice for those with a variety of gadgets.

Smart charging technology enhances the user experience by enabling faster charging through advanced protocols. This is particularly useful for the Axon 7, which can benefit from such technology to maximize battery life and efficiency.

Build quality and safety features are paramount to ensure that the charger lasts and operates safely. A charger constructed from high-quality materials and equipped with safety mechanisms will protect both the charger and your Axon 7 from potential electrical issues.

Finally, indicator lights provide a simple way to monitor the charger’s battery status. Knowing how much power is left in your portable charger can help you plan ahead and avoid running out of juice when you need it most.

How Does Battery Capacity Affect Charger Performance for the Axon 7?

Battery capacity significantly influences charger performance for the Axon 7 by determining how quickly and efficiently the device can be charged.

  • Charger Output (Amperage): The higher the amperage output of the charger, the faster it can replenish the battery capacity of the Axon 7.
  • Battery Capacity (mAh): The total milliamp hours (mAh) rating of the Axon 7’s battery impacts how long it takes to charge from a portable charger.
  • Charging Technology: Different charging technologies, such as Quick Charge, can enhance the efficiency of the charging process based on the battery capacity.
  • Charger Compatibility: Using a charger that matches the Axon 7’s battery specifications ensures optimal performance without risking damage to the device.
  • Heat Generation: Higher battery capacity can lead to increased heat during charging, affecting performance and longevity of both the battery and charger.

Charger Output (Amperage): The output amperage of a charger determines how much current flows into the Axon 7 during charging. A charger with a higher amperage (such as 2A or 3A) can provide a quicker charge compared to standard 1A chargers, making it essential to choose a charger that offers sufficient output for fast charging.

Battery Capacity (mAh): The Axon 7 features a battery capacity of 3,250 mAh, which means that the charger needs to deliver enough power to fully charge the device without excessive downtime. A charger with a higher capacity can provide multiple charges before needing to be recharged itself, making it more suitable for users who are frequently on the go.

Charging Technology: Technologies like Qualcomm Quick Charge can significantly reduce charging times by allowing higher voltage and current to flow based on the battery capacity. This means that with a compatible charger, the Axon 7 can charge to a substantial percentage in a short period, enhancing user experience by minimizing waiting times.

Charger Compatibility: Choosing a charger that is specifically designed for the Axon 7 or meets its charging specifications is crucial for maintaining performance. Incompatible chargers may charge slower or may not utilize the device’s full charging potential, ultimately leading to longer charging times.

Heat Generation: During the charging process, particularly with higher capacities, heat can become a concern as excessive heat can impact battery health over time. Thus, it is important to monitor the heat generated during charging to ensure that both the charger and the Axon 7 remain within safe operational temperatures to prolong their lifespan.

What Safety Considerations Should You Keep in Mind When Using a Portable Charger with the Axon 7?

When using a portable charger with the Axon 7, it is essential to keep several safety considerations in mind to ensure both device functionality and user safety.

  • Compatibility: Ensure that the portable charger is compatible with the Axon 7’s charging requirements, specifically its voltage and amperage specifications. Using a charger that does not match these can lead to inefficient charging or potential damage to the device.
  • Overcharge Protection: Choose a portable charger that features overcharge protection to prevent the battery from continuing to charge once it is full. This feature helps to extend the lifespan of both the charger and the phone’s battery, safeguarding against overheating.
  • Temperature Management: Monitor the temperature of the portable charger during use, as excessive heat can pose a risk. Select chargers that have built-in temperature management systems to automatically regulate heat, ensuring safe operation.
  • Quality and Certification: Opt for chargers from reputable brands that meet safety certifications such as UL, CE, or FCC. High-quality chargers are less likely to malfunction or pose safety hazards, providing peace of mind while charging your Axon 7.
  • Cable Quality: Use high-quality charging cables that are designed for the Axon 7 to prevent short circuits or damage. Poorly made cables can lead to electrical hazards and should be checked for fraying or damage before each use.
  • Environment Considerations: Avoid using the portable charger in extreme temperatures or humid conditions. Exposure to such environments can negatively impact the performance of the charger and lead to safety issues such as battery swelling or leakage.

How Can You Maintain the Longevity of Your Axon 7 Battery with External Chargers?

To maintain the longevity of your Axon 7 battery while using external chargers, consider the following aspects:

  • High-Quality Portable Charger: Choose a reputable brand that offers a reliable and efficient charger specifically designed for the Axon 7.
  • Capacity and Output: Select a charger with the right capacity and output to ensure it provides optimal charging speed without overloading your device.
  • Smart Charging Technology: Look for chargers equipped with smart charging features to prevent overheating and overcharging.
  • Battery Health Monitoring: Utilize apps or features that monitor battery health to prevent degradation while charging with external sources.
  • Charging Habits: Adopt good charging practices, such as avoiding charging overnight and using the charger only when necessary.

High-Quality Portable Charger: Investing in a high-quality portable battery charger is essential for ensuring that it safely and effectively charges your Axon 7. Chargers from reputable brands are more likely to have the necessary protective features that prevent damage to your device and prolong battery life.

Capacity and Output: When selecting an external charger, consider one with a capacity of at least 10,000 mAh, which can provide multiple charges for your Axon 7. The output should be compatible with your device’s requirements, ideally around 2A, to ensure efficient and safe charging.

Smart Charging Technology: Chargers that incorporate smart charging technology can automatically adjust the power output based on your device’s needs. This feature helps to prevent overheating, which can significantly impact battery lifespan and performance over time.

Battery Health Monitoring: Utilizing apps that monitor the health of your battery can provide insights into its condition while using external chargers. These tools can alert you to potential issues like excessive heat or charge cycles that could shorten battery life.

Charging Habits: Establishing good charging habits is crucial for battery longevity. Avoid leaving your Axon 7 plugged in overnight and try to charge it when it drops to around 20% to 30%, as this practice can help maintain a healthier battery cycle.
